How Do Truck Accident Lawyer Tyler Determine Negligence and Liability?

When pursuing compensation with a Truck Accident Lawyer Tyler, you and your attorney must prove that the driver or another party acted negligently. This requires establishing the following elements:

Duty of Care

All drivers, including truck drivers, are obligated to follow traffic laws and drive carefully and responsibly to ensure the safety of everyone on the road. This duty, known as the duty of care, is intended to hold drivers accountable for any injuries caused to others as a result of their negligence.

Similarly, companies engaged in trucking, loading, maintenance, and manufacturing are also responsible for exercising a duty of care towards individuals who come into contact with the semi-trucks they operate, own, load, or maintain.

Breach of Duty

A breach of duty happens when a party fails to exercise reasonable care, often due to negligence or intentional misconduct. For example, a driver breaches their duty if they violate a traffic law, such as speeding in hazardous conditions or driving recklessly.

Damages

In accident claims, damages include financial, physical, and subjective losses. These losses must be quantified and included in a compensation request. Evidence such as medical bills, income records, and expert testimony can help substantiate these losses.

However, accident victims frequently find it challenging to establish these elements when filing insurance claims. An attorney can help calculate financial costs and estimate personal losses, such as emotional distress and reduced quality of life.

What Are the Primary Causes of Truck Accident Lawyer Tyler?

Statistics on large truck crashes are regularly compiled, and recent estimates reveal the top ten most common factors:

  1. Brake problems: 29%
  2. Traveling too fast for conditions: 23%
  3. Unfamiliarity with the roadway: 22%
  4. Roadway problems: 20%
  5. Over-the-counter drug use: 17%
  6. Inadequate surveillance: 14%
  7. Fatigue: 13%
  8. Experienced pressure from the employer: 10%
  9. Made an illegal maneuver: 9%
  10. Inattention: 9%

Large Trucks and the Accidents They Cause

In addition to semis, many other large trucks and vehicles have the potential to cause significant property damage and severe injuries. These include:

  • Tankers
  • Cement trucks
  • Rental trucks
  • Garbage trucks
  • Dump trucks
  • Flatbed trucks
  • Utility trucks
  • Commercial trucks
  • Delivery trucks
  • Construction vehicles

Various types of accidents involving semis and other large commercial trucks can occur, such as:

  • Truck or semi-trailer rollovers
  • Tanker truck or chemical spill accidents
  • Override or underride accidents
  • Jackknifing accidents
  • Sideswipe accidents
  • Blind spot and cut-off accidents
  • Wide right turn accidents

National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A), there were an estimated 159,000 injuries from significant truck accidents in 2019, followed by another 147,000 in 2020. Additionally, there were 4,842 considerable truck accidents involved in fatal crashes, marking a 33% increase since 2011.

Truck collisions often result in more severe injuries than typical auto accidents, leading to significant damage and a higher risk of catastrophic, life-threatening, or fatal injuries. These injuries may include:

  • Head and traumatic brain injuries
  • Concussions
  • Whiplash and neck injuries
  • Collar bone injuries
  • Broken or fractured bones
  • Crush injuries
  • Back and spinal cord injuries
  • Paralysis
  • Vision or hearing loss
  • Limb loss/amputation
  • Deep cuts and lacerations
  • Internal bleeding
  • Blunt force or penetrating trauma
  • Organ damage
  • Soft tissue injuries
  • Psychological trauma
